| Programming Highlights: Mayor of Stratford to Make a Special Announcement with Lloyd Robertson on August 24 at City Hall |
| Posted
on Monday, August 22, 2011 - 06:55 PM |
On September 1, Lloyd Robertson will deliver his final newscast as the Chief Anchor and Senior Editor of CTV News. In honour of this momentous occasion, Dan Mathieson, Mayor of Stratford, Ontario has declared September 1 to be Lloyd Robertson Day in Stratford. In addition, Mayor Mathieson will be making an announcement in front of City Hall on Wednesday, August 24. Lloyd Robertson and his wife, Nancy Robertson, will be in attendance. Details below:

| Programming Highlights: Discovery Channel and Bell Media’s Factual Channels Announce Cross-Platform Coverage Commemorating the 10th Anniversary of 9/11 |
| Posted
on Wednesday, August 17, 2011 - 04:03 PM |
On the morning of Sept. 11, 2001, al Qaeda terrorists hijacked four commercial passenger jet airliners and flew them into various sites in the U.S. killing nearly 3,000 people in the worst attack on the American mainland in over a half-century. It was a day that will live in infamy. And now, with exactly one month to go before the 10th anniversary of these horrific, history-altering attacks, Discovery Channel and Bell Media’s factual channels announced today cross-platform coverage of the historic anniversary over four days in September. Beginning Sept. 8 and running through to the anniversary itself on Sept. 11, Discovery Channel and Bell Media’s factual channels will commemorate the 10th anniversary of 9/11 with extensive and exclusive programming.

| Programming Highlights: Bravo! Lays Down the Law with Two New Series, FRANKLIN & BASH and SUITS, Premiering August 22 |
| Posted
on Thursday, July 28, 2011 - 05:33 PM |
It’s a race to the courthouse as Bravo! welcomes an irreverent team of leading lawyers to its Monday night lineup, beginningAugust 22. First on the docket, comedy-dramaFRANKLIN & BASH, airingMondays at 9 p.m. ET, kicks off the proceedings with the first of two back-to-back premieres, exclusively on Bravo! Starring Mark-Paul Gosselaar (NYPD BLUE) and Breckin Meyer (Road Trip), the hour-long series zeros in on a pair of non-traditional, bad-boy, street lawyers recruited to join one of Los Angeles’ top law firms. TNT recently announced that the series has been green lit for a second season on the heels of a strong summer debut. Next up, is the hour-long drama SUITS, airing Mondays at 10 p.m. ET. Starring Gabriel Macht (Love and Other Drugs) along with Toronto-nativePatrick J. Adams (LOST, FRIDAY NIGHT LIGHTS), the pair play the best legal closer in New York and the college-dropout genius he takes under his wing. Shot in New York and Toronto, the series launches with a special 90-minute premiere episode (visit bravo.ca to confirm local broadcast times).
